Brazil

TechnipFMC said its spoolbase at Açu Port, Rio de Janeiro has carried out its first rigid pipes spooling operation, as part of the Mero 1 project (FPSO Guanabara), located in the Mero field, Santos Basin offshore Brazil. The vessel responsible for the loading and installation on this project is Deep Blue, TechnipFMC’s most modern rigid pipe laying vessel, the co. said 8 Apr. 2022 on Instagram. The Mero unitized field is operated by Petrobras (WI 38.6%), in partnership w/ Shell Brasil (WI 19.3%), TotalEnergies (WI 19.3%), CNPC (WI 9.65%), CNOOC Limited (WI 9.65%) and Pré-Sal Petróleo SA -PPSA (WI 3.5%), representing the union in the non-contracted area.

Mexico

Silver Viper Minerals Corp. (TSXV: VIPR) provided an update on exploration activities within the La Virginia Silver-Gold Project, located in Sonora, Mexico. Exploration efforts since the release of Silver Viper’s Maiden NI 43-101 gold-silver mineral resource estimate have continued to advance w/ exploration drilling at El Rubi and expansion of mapping and sampling coverage across the project area. Recent drilling has been performed at the Paredones Zone on the eastern structural/mineralized trend. Quantec Geoscience contractors have now completed data collection for a 31 line-kms Magnetotelluric geophysical survey covering ~610 hectares (1,500 acres). Final deliverables from the survey are expected in the coming wks, Silver Viper said 8 Apr. 2022 in an official stmt.
